Treatment and use of phosphorous slurry is a very important, because it can not only influence the collection ratio and produce cost, but also cause environmental pollution, So almost all of phosphor factories are exploring and practicing treatment of the phosphorus slurry.Though researchers in the world have done much laborious exploration to treatment and use of phosphorous slurry, any suit efficient and ripe way hasn't been found. Ways of distilling yellow phosphor from phosphorous slurry in the world now, including: Evaporating phosphor, medicaments, absorption and vacuum filtration treatment, treatment in the electric field, absorption and separation and so on. Because there is some defect and existing problem themselves in these ways of distilling phosphor, they aren't used widely.Presently, the most research on ways of distilling yellow phosphor from phosphorous slurry in domestic is the way of evaporating phosphor, But it exists these disadvantages: the life of the evaporating phosphor boiler is short, the ratio of the phosphor reclamation is low, economic benefit is bad. In order to lower the pollution to environment, raise the ratio of phosphor reclamation, the author designed and improved the equipment of distilling yellow phosphor. On the basis of former experiment, the author of this designed the new equipment for distilling yellow phosphor in phosphorous slurry at mid-temperature, and run and tested the equipment with the material (phosphorous slurry) which is brought from a factory in Malong county in Qujing city to observe and study its character to find and solve the problems in the experiment. The author analyzed how temperature, pressure, operation time influenced the recycle ratio and the contents of Arsenic in yellow phosphorus product.After the phosphorous slurry was treated by the new equipment which was designed in the experiment, these conclusions are gained: 1) The reclamation ratio is 98.6%. 2) The percent of Phosphor and Arsenic in yellow phosphor is respectively 99.96% and 63.7ppm.3) The percent of Phosphor and Arsenic in phosphorous residue is respectively 5.36% and 10.58ppm.The relation of cost to benefit in distilling yellow phosphor from phosphorous slurry at mid-temperature was discussed and elementary conclusion to economic feasibility of was worked out.At the present, The emphasis of researches on distilling yellow phosphor in phosphorous slurry is the design of the equipment but there is a lot of work to do. We believe that the improved and optimized the new equipment in distilling yellow phosphor from phosphorous slurry at mid-temperature will be applied widely.
